## Environments: Profile Store Sharding

Quick context for reviewers: Thistledown's user-profile store is now sharded by account hash across four partitions in staging (prod gets eight). Rebalancing runs nightly, so don't panic if shard counts look uneven mid-review. Staging currently runs with the following configuration.

deployment values, yahag-tawef:
ZORWYN_HOST=zorwyn.tolvaqlabs.internal
ZORWYN_PORT=9300

## SpoolKeep Release — Step 6

Before promoting the SpoolKeep printer-spooler microservice, confirm the job-queue migration completed on all three regions and that stale spool entries were purged. A partial purge will duplicate print jobs on restart, so verify counts match the audit log. Finally, sign the release manifest with the key below.

deploy key for kajof-fajop: bky6_gDHw9Q

- [ ] **Step 7: Breaker override escrow.** After sealing the signing keys for the Tallgrove upstream API circuit breaker, confirm the support team can force the breaker open during a full outage. The override bundle lives in the sealed escrow drawer and is useless without its unlock phrase. Two ceremony witnesses must initial this step before proceeding. The escrow bundle is decrypted with the recovery passphrase that follows.

vault phrase of kahip-kahop = holath-quenmir

Capacity note for new folks: we're upgrading the Quillbus broker from 5.x to 6.x next quarter. The big deal is that 6.x keeps per-partition indexes in memory, so our current nodes will run hot unless we trim retention or add RAM. Rule of thumb: budget about 1.3x today's heap. Don't copy the old config over — half the knobs were renamed and the defaults changed underneath us. The settings we've validated in staging so far are:

tuning constants:
TIERS = {
    "sorion": 670,
    "istax": 547,
}

## Scanwright 4.2 — Changed defaults

Breaking for plugin authors. Barcode scanner integration now defaults to continuous-scan mode; single-shot must be requested explicitly. Symbology auto-detect is on by default, and the legacy beep callback is removed. Plugins targeting 4.1 behavior must pin the compatibility flag before init. New defaults ship as listed in the configuration below.

config for fajof-badug:
holael:
  log_level: error
  metrics_host: metrics.holael.tolvaqsys.internal
  pool_size: 32